The Anaesthetic Crisis Manual Version 4 now available
The Anaesthetic Crisis Manual (The ACM) is a practical quick-reference manual in aviation checklist format, giving step-by-step instructions for the management of the most common anaesthetic crises encountered in the operating room.
60 crisis management and prevention protocols cover the major scenarios requiring immediate therapeutic intervention to prevent a catastrophic outcome. These include life-threatening cardiac, circulatory, airway, respiratory, metabolic and drug induced events.
This updated version of the original and first commercially available crisis management cognitive aid, continues to be a must for the anaesthetist, trainee, CRNA, peri-operative nurse and operating room.
